Accelerated Discovery of High Performance Ni3S4/Ni3Mo HER Catalysts via Bayesian Optimization
Integrated workflow accelerates the catalyst discovery of hydrogen evolution reaction via Bayesian optimization. An experiment‐trained surrogate model proposes synthesis conditions, guiding iterative refinement using electrochemical performance metrics.

The transitory evolutionary spectrum
Proceedings of ICASSP '94. IEEE International Conference on Acoustics, Speech and Signal Processing, 2002Propose a new definition for the time-dependent spectrum of a non-stationary process. The authors show that this spectrum can be considered as the dual of Priestley's (1981) evolutionary spectrum.
